Output ed81bda03072c28ed43b724c00b3d0bb024fbb7ed2eac2f02ea7e2d7f027193d:0

value
134577
script pubkey
OP_0 OP_PUSHBYTES_20 2bd9f19c02f03cf54e5dda560ad859b72940ff20
address
bc1q90vlr8qz7q702njamftq4kzeku55pleqv35qld
transaction
ed81bda03072c28ed43b724c00b3d0bb024fbb7ed2eac2f02ea7e2d7f027193d
confirmations
248175
spent
true